Comprehending the Landscape of OTC Pain Relievers
Before buying, it assists to understand that not all pain relievers work the very same way. Typically, OTC pain medications fall under 2 main classifications based on how they interact with the body: Acetaminophen and Nonsteroidal Anti-in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s).
1. Acetaminophen (e.g., Tylenol)
Acetaminophen acts mostly on the central nerve system to block pain signals and decrease fever. Unlike NSAIDs, it does not reduce inflammation or swelling.
- Best utilized for: Headaches, sore throats, basic pains, and minimizing fevers.
- Secret advantage: It is generally gentler on the stomach lining than NSAIDs, making it a more secure option for individuals with a history of ulcers or gastritis.
2. Nonsteroidal Anti-in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s)
NSAIDs-- which include ibuprofen (Advil, Motrin), naproxen salt (Aleve), and aspirin-- work by inhibiting enzymes in the body that produce prostaglandins, the chemicals that set off pain and swelling.
- Best utilized for: Conditions involving swelling and tissue inflammation, such as arthritis, muscle sprains, menstrual cramps, and oral pain.
- Key advantage: They take on both the sensation of pain and the underlying inflammation triggering it.

When standing in the Online Pharmacy For Pain Relief aisle, consumers need to look beyond the strong marketing claims on the front of package and focus on the "Drug Facts" label on the back. Think about the following vital aspects:
1. Identify the Source of the Pain
- Inflammatory pain (e.g., a twisted ankle, arthritis, or a sports injury) responds finest to NSAIDs like ibuprofen or naproxen.
- General hurts (e.g., a stress headache or moderate fever) can be effectively managed with acetaminophen.
2. Look For Hidden Ingredients in Combination Products
Numerous cold, influenza, and sinus medications contain acetaminophen or NSAIDs as a secondary component.
- The Danger: A consumer may take a cold medication consisting of acetaminophen and simultaneously take a dose of Tylenol for a headache, inadvertently resulting in an overdose. Always check out labels to track overall everyday consumption.
3. Think About Duration and Dosage Frequency
- Ibuprofen usually lasts 4 to 6 hours.
- Acetaminophen usually lasts 4 to 6 hours.
- Naproxen sodium offers longer-lasting relief, typically 8 to 12 hours per dose, making it convenient for those who want to prevent regular pill-taking throughout the workday.
4. Unique Health Considerations
Specific populations must exercise extreme caution when acquiring painkiller:
- Individuals with hypertension or kidney disease: NSAIDs can raise high blood pressure and stress the kidneys. Acetaminophen is typically advised as a safer option (though high blood pressure ought to still be monitored).
- Pregnant people: Generally, acetaminophen is preferred throughout pregnancy, especially in the third trimester, as NSAIDs can cause complications for the developing fetus. Constantly speak with a doctor.
- Children and teenagers: Aspirin should never ever be provided to children or teenagers recovering from viral infections (like chickenpox or the influenza) due to the threat of Reye's syndrome, an uncommon but deadly condition. Usage kids's formulations of acetaminophen or ibuprofen based on weight and age charts.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I take ibuprofen and acetaminophen together?
Yes, many doctors advise alternating ibuprofen and acetaminophen for severe pain (such as post-surgical recovery or high fevers that withstand single medications). Nevertheless, this ought to only be done under the assistance of a health care professional to guarantee dosing schedules do not overlap incorrectly and strain the liver or kidneys.
Does generic store-brand pain relief work along with name brands?
Yes. According to regulatory standards, generic medications need to include the specific very same active ingredients, strength, and dose form as their name-brand equivalents. Choosing store brands can considerably reduce costs without jeopardizing efficacy.
What is the optimum safe dosage of acetaminophen for grownups?
For healthy grownups, the optimum advised everyday dosage of acetaminophen is generally 4,000 milligrams (mg) daily from all sources combined. Exceeding this limitation can cause extreme, possibly deadly liver damage. Individuals with liver conditions should speak with a medical professional for a lower advised threshold.
The length of time is it safe to take OTC pain reducers continuously?
OTC pain relievers are developed for short-term management of acute symptoms. Generally, if pain persists for more than 10 days in grownups (or 5 days for fever), or more than 3 days in children, stop taking the medication and speak with a doctor. Persistent pain needs a detailed diagnosis and treatment plan customized by a doctor.
